Franklin County, MO Roof Snow Load - 20 psf
Franklin County, MO roof snow load, translated
A typical heated home in Franklin County is designed to carry 20 pounds per square foot of snow on its roof, per ASCE 7-22. The physics-based figure alone would be 14 psf, but ASCE 7's own low-slope minimum (§7.3.4) sets a floor of 20 psf for flat and low-pitch roofs here, which is the number that actually governs.
On a roof that means 44 in. of fresh snow, 16 in. once it packs down, or 4 in. of solid ice - three very different piles for the same load. A meaningful design load. Most homes built to modern code handle it, but additions, carports, and flat-roofed sections are worth a second look.

Franklin County: average annual snowfall
Franklin County sees about 13.5 in. of snow most winters, per the WELDON SPRING NWS, MO US station's 1991-2020 NOAA normal. Worth noting: the nearest station reporting snowfall normals sits 28.9 mi from Franklin County's center, so treat this as a regional figure rather than an exact one. See the density guide.
Read this before you use Franklin County's figure
The figure above assumes the case ASCE 7-22 treats as typical: a heated, ordinary-occupancy home on a partially exposed site. Change any of those - exposure, heating, roof pitch, occupancy category - and the real design number moves.
A building permit needs the number at your exact address, not the county average - the free ASCE 7 Hazard Tool returns that from your coordinates in about a minute and produces a PDF a plan reviewer will accept. Details: the calculation guide.
